大象基金的有个文件找不到 而且全是 报错 想请教一下怎么解决
最主要是那个文件在项目包里找不到
大象基金的有个文件找不到 而且全是 报错 想请教一下怎么解决
最主要是那个文件在项目包里找不到
引自免费微信小程序:皆我百晓生
对于你在大象基金项目中遇到的问题,如果你遇到了某个文件找不到并且报错的情况,可以尝试以下几个步骤来解决这个问题:
检查文件路径:
确保你在代码中引用文件的路径是正确的。Java中的文件路径通常是相对于当前类的包或者项目的根目录的。例如,如果你的文件位于src/main/resources
目录下的一个名为config
的子目录内,你应该这样引用它:new File("config/yourfile.txt")
。
确认文件存在: 确保文件确实存在于指定的路径中。有时候可能是因为文件被意外删除、移动或者重命名了。可以在IDE(如IntelliJ IDEA, Eclipse, VS Code等)中查看项目结构,或者直接在文件系统的对应位置查找这个文件。
清理并重新构建项目:
有时IDE缓存可能会导致问题,尝试清除项目缓存并重新构建。在IntelliJ IDEA中,可以通过菜单栏的 Build
-> Rebuild Project
来执行此操作。
检查Maven或Gradle配置:
如果你的项目使用的是Maven或Gradle作为构建工具,确保文件已经被正确地包含在构建路径中。例如,在Maven中,资源文件通常放在src/main/resources
下,并会自动包含到编译输出中。如果文件不在默认的位置,你需要在pom.xml中添加对应的资源目录配置。这是一个例子:
<build>
<resources>
<resource>
<directory>src/main/extras</directory>
</resource>
</resources>
</build>
对于Gradle,类似的操作是在build.gradle
文件中添加资源源集:
sourceSets {
main {
resources {
srcDirs 'src/main/extras'
}
}
}
排除IDE问题: 如果上述方法都无效,可能是IDE的问题。关闭IDE后,手动清理工作空间,然后重新打开项目并尝试编译运行。
查阅错误信息: 错误信息通常会提供一些关于找不到文件的具体线索,比如哪个类在哪个行数试图加载这个文件,这可以帮助你定位问题。
搜索相关依赖: 如果文件是某个库的一部分,确保你已经正确引入了相关的依赖。
寻求社区帮助: 如果问题依然存在,你可以将具体的错误信息、文件路径以及相关的代码片段分享出来,这样能更具体地分析问题。你也可以在Stack Overflow或者其他技术论坛上提问,带上足够的上下文信息,以便他人能更好地帮助你。
如果你需要进一步的帮助,尤其是代码示例或者具体操作步骤,请随时告诉我,我会根据情况提供详细的指导。